Commands for International Fonts
ESC
R n
Select an International Character Set
Format
ASC
ESC
R
n
Hex
1B
52
n
Decimal
27
82
n
Range
0 n 13
Description
Selects an international character set n from
the
following table:
N
Character set
0
U.S.A.
1
Franch
2
Germany
3
U.K.
4
Denmark
5
Sweden
6
Italy
7
Spain
8
Japan
9
Norway
10
Denmark
11
Spain
12
Latin America
13
Korea
Default
n=0

Character code can also be selected by utility
program.
1. To install the PRP-080 Default Code Page
Setting utility, please insert the
bundled CD disk into the CD-ROM drive.
2. In the CD-Rom menu, please go to Receipt
Printer > PRP-080 > Code Page
and double click the setup.exe file to begin
the installation process and
follow the installation instructions.
3. After installation is done, go to Program
Files > CodePageSet >
CodePageSet to start the utility.
4. For Serial interface connection, please
select the proper COM port and baud
rate which matches the current setting of the
printer. For Parallel interface
connection, select the proper LPT ports.

Optional multilingual character model supports
printing with one of the
following characters:
To enable/disable the multilingual character
code use the following
commands: (*)
a. B - Traditional Chinese (Big 5)
b. G - Simplify Chinese (GB)
c. K - Korean
d. J- Japanese Kanji (JIS)
FS
&
Select Multilingual Character Mode ON
[Format]
ASCII
FS
&
Hex
1C
26
Decimal
28
38
[Description] Enable multilingual character
mode
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
FS
.
Select Multilingual Character Mode OFF
[Format]
ASCII
FS
.
Hex
1C
2E
Decimal
28
46
[Description] Disable multilingual character
mode
(*)Note: This command enable/disable the
specific language according to
the model (B, G, K or J)
